Understanding Ethanol and Its Blends
Ethanol, a type of alcohol, is blended with gasoline to create a fuel mixture known as E10 (10% ethanol), E15 (15% ethanol), and higher blends. The percentage of ethanol in the blend determines its octane rating and energy content. E10 is the most common blend used in the United States, while E15 is becoming increasingly prevalent in some regions.
Benefits of Ethanol Blends
- Reduced Greenhouse Gas Emissions: Ethanol is a renewable fuel that can help reduce greenhouse gas emissions compared to traditional gasoline.
- Increased Octane Rating: Ethanol has a higher octane rating than gasoline, which can improve engine performance and reduce knocking.
- Energy Independence: Using ethanol reduces dependence on foreign oil imports, promoting energy security.
Drawbacks of Ethanol Blends
- Lower Energy Content: Ethanol has a lower energy content per gallon than gasoline, which can result in reduced fuel economy.
- Engine Corrosion: Ethanol can absorb moisture, leading to corrosion in fuel systems and engines.
- Compatibility Issues: Some older vehicles may not be compatible with higher ethanol blends, potentially causing engine damage.
Can You Run Non-Ethanol Gas in a Car?
The answer to this question depends on your vehicle’s make, model, and year. Modern vehicles are generally designed to handle E10 blends without any issues. However, older cars, especially those manufactured before 2001, may not be compatible with ethanol. It’s crucial to consult your vehicle’s owner’s manual to determine the recommended fuel type.
Checking Your Vehicle’s Compatibility
Your vehicle’s owner’s manual is the best source of information regarding its fuel compatibility. Look for a section on fuel specifications or recommendations. The manual will typically state the maximum ethanol content your vehicle can handle.
If you can’t locate your owner’s manual, you can also check the fuel door. Some vehicles have a sticker on the fuel door indicating the recommended fuel type.

Where to Find Non-Ethanol Gas
While E10 is the most common gasoline blend, non-ethanol gas (also known as pure gasoline or E0) is available at select gas stations.
Identifying Non-Ethanol Gas Stations
- Look for signage: Many gas stations that offer non-ethanol gasoline will display clear signage indicating its availability.
- Check online resources: Websites and apps like GasBuddy and AAA TripTik can help you locate gas stations that sell non-ethanol gas in your area.
- Contact gas stations directly: If you’re unsure, you can always call a local gas station to inquire about their fuel offerings.
Cost Considerations
Non-ethanol gasoline typically costs more than ethanol-blended gasoline. The price difference can vary depending on your location and the availability of non-ethanol gas.
